Field Hockey opens season with 3-1 win over Washington (Md.)

OWINGS MILLS, Md. - Stevenson Field Hockey opened their 2024 campaign this evening on the East Campus against Washington College (Md.). The Mustangs maintained a lead after scoring just over one minute into the game, leading them to an eventual 3-1 triumph.

The Mustangs wasted no time getting on the scoreboard as sophomore Lauren Schulz became the first scorer of the season one minute and 15 seconds in. Schulz converted a pair of passes from junior newcomer Hailey Mertz and graduate student Emma Gladstein off of Stevenson's first corner of the night.

Washington spent the next thirty minutes fighting to find some offense, but they were shut down by sophomore goalkeeper Jordan Vradenburgh, who made two stops in the first half.

Less than two minutes into the second half, first year Coco Wallace notched her first career goal with assistance from sophomore newcomer Shae Bennett to put the Mustangs up 2-0. 

Though the Shorewomen would find some offensive luck in the third, senior Haley Palmer scored the Mustangs' insurance goal via Emma Gladstein with three minutes remaining in the contest. Palmer would also lead the Mustangs in shots with two.

Vradenburgh added three more saves to end the night with five, and the Mustangs' sixth stop was provided by sophomore Sarah Bisson with her defensive save in the first quarter.
